Forza Horizon 6 Suspends The Eliminator Mode Following Major Glitch

The in-game economy of Forza Horizon 6 recently faced an unprecedented disruption following a critical matchmaking exploit. In response, developer Playground Games has initiated a swift wave of account rollbacks, wiping billions of illegitimate credits from the ecosystem to preserve the integrity of the multiplayer experience.

Playground Games has taken decisive action against a lucrative in-game economy exploit in Forza Horizon 6. While the immediate suspension of The Eliminator has left the broader community waiting for a permanent hotfix, the development team is already offering reparations.

As a gesture of goodwill for disabling The Eliminator mode over the weekend, Playground Games is distributing a free 2021 McLaren Sabre to all players via the in-game Message Center once the mode is restored.

Why Were Forza Horizon 6 Bank Balances Rolled Back?

Players discovered a method to trigger massive credit payouts by placing a GMC Hummer EV into a glitched state before entering matchmaking for The Eliminator.

Playground Games confirmed via an official Forza Support FAQ that an automated sweep has restored offending accounts to a maximum of 10 million credits.

This exploit allowed individuals to quickly accumulate up to 999,999,999 credits without legitimately winning matches. The rollback serves as an automated correction to preserve the integrity of the in-game economy on Xbox Series X|S and PC.

The developer clarified that because the error originated on their side, no permanent bans or further actions will be taken against the affected accounts.

What Is the Status of The Eliminator and Player Compensation?

Matchmaking for The Eliminator remains temporarily disabled while the development team works on a permanent hotfix for the mode.

The broader community, including those who did not participate in the glitch, is currently unable to access this specific multiplayer feature.

To address the downtime, Playground Games is offering a make-good vehicle to the entire player base. The compensation will be available via the in-game Gifts tab as soon as the mode’s servers are brought back online.

When Will The Eliminator Matchmaking Return?

Playground Games plans to reintroduce The Eliminator as soon as possible via a hotfix. A specific release date for this patch has not been announced, but the studio is actively developing the necessary corrections to address the GMC Hummer EV credits glitch.
